It Pays To Follow Posted on June 6, 2023June 6, 2023 | Posted by Digby Beacham BREAD TO FLIRT Saturday, June 3 @ Belmont Park BREAD TO FLIRT: A wonderful return to racing by this mare. The daughter of Gingerbread Man is a quality wet tracker and showed her effectiveness with a little juice in the track last Saturday, stomping home from last on the turn over 1000m to finish a one-length second to the rock-hard fit Ultimate Command. BLACKWATER BAY Saturday, June 3 @ Belmont Park Hadn’t raced for a month and was sporting bar shoes, yet still managed to grab second to one of the form horses in WA in Fear The Wind. It was only his third run this time in and we know how effective Adam Durrant-trained stayers are over the winter months. BITOFMERIT Saturday, June 3 @ Belmont Park A terrific, albeit luckless, return to racing. Had just the one trial leading into the weekend’s assignment. It wasn’t that which proved a hindrance on the weekend. Rather, his tardiness out of the gates and an inability to build momentum in the straight when Lucy Fiore would have liked. ALL DAY SESSION Saturday, June 3 @ Belmont Park Caught the eye in 72+ grade over 1200m after finishing out of the placings in twin 66+ company runs to open his preparation. He was unable to establish a clear path in the straight from the low draw until the bird had flown, yet still ran third behind Rokanori and Vane Tempest. UPPER LIMITS Saturday, June 3 @ Belmont Park Just a really nice horse who has come back in excellent order. Was second-up in the Raconteur Stakes over 1400m on the weekend and disadvantaged by a high draw. Despite that, rattled home from a rearward spot to grab third, less than two lengths off Vast Art. Dual stakes placed, it wouldn’t be a shock if this gelding took out the Belmont Guineas.
